CLEMENS, Senior Judge.
Appeal from summary denial of a Rule 27.26 motion.
In 1976 a jury found movant-defendant Wendell W. Wright guilty of felonious assault and robbery. The trial court sentenced him as a prior felon to consecutive prison terms of thirty-five years and life. He appealed and the judgment was affirmed. See State v. Wright,
